Ida E. Dodge was born in LaSalle County, Ill., September 24, 1863 and passed away at the family home in Grinnell, Iowa, October 1, 1927. In 1865 she came with her parents to Malcom, Iowa where she resided until her marriage to Mr. William Harris in 1877. They established their home on a farm at Oak Grove. From the farm they moved to Grinnell where they have lived for twenty two years.

She was the mother of five children, all of whom survive her and were present with her during her illness. The children are Elbert and Harold of Grinnell, Dwight of Denver, Mrs. Ada Boelke of Pasadena, Cal., Mrs. Donna Schilling of Sigourney, Iowa. Besides the husband and children she leaves one sister, Mrs. Della Corrough of Grinnell and two brothers, Edward and Worth of California.

Mrs. Harris was a woman who was greatly beloved by her family and by all her friends and neighbors. She patiently endured her serious illness through several weeks. At the last she fell asleep and passed away in peace.

Funeral services were held at the home on Summer Street on Sunday afternoon conducted by the Rev. George Blagg. Burial was made in Hazelwood.
